The Quarrelstone migration service applies schema changes with zero downtime by running expand and contract phases separately. Future maintainers should always ship the expand phase, wait one full deploy cycle, then backfill before contracting. All migration requests go through the Hollowgate coordinator, which authenticates each call using the internal key below.

service key, yadug-bajog: zpat3_pou

Subject: SquatHound cut-over complete

The SquatHound typo-squatting scanner is now live against the Millbrand internal registry, replacing the legacy Kestrel scripts. Detection rules carried over unchanged; alert routing now goes through the on-call queue. False-positive rate over the first 48 hours matched staging. Legacy scripts are disabled but retained for thirty days. For your review, the production service runs with these configuration values.

deployment values, yadug-bawif:
[framir]
team = pelox
access_code = ac_a38ab2
owner = tamion.julael
host = framir.tolvaqlabs.test
port = 11211
peer = tammir.zemvargrid.local
salt = 2215ef03
pin = 1541

The Fareline ticket-pricing experiment adjusts displayed fares for a 5% traffic cohort and logs every price decision with its seed and variant. Security-relevant concerns — cohort assignment integrity, PII in decision logs, or tampering with the variant table — should not go through the general experimentation queue. The experiment owner rotates quarterly; the current owner and the standing reviewer are listed in the governance register. For security review questions, contact the pricing-integrity group at the address below.

pager mailbox: silael.sorwyn.tamius@zemvarsys.corp